
知识库搜索优化的必备策略分享
引言
知识库作为企业信息化建设的核心资产,其搜索功能的体验直接决定了用户能否快速获取所需信息。越来越多的企业发现,尽管投入大量资源构建知识库,但搜索结果的相关性低、响应速度慢、用户满意度不高等问题依然突出。这些痛点不仅影响内部协作效率,更直接关系到客户服务体验与业务决策质量。
本文基于当前行业实践与技术现状,梳理知识库搜索优化面临的核心挑战,剖析问题背后的深层原因,并结合小浣熊AI智能助手在信息检索领域的技术探索,提出具有可操作性的改进策略。
一、知识库搜索优化的核心挑战
1.1 搜索结果相关性不足
这是企业知识库面临的首要痛点。用户输入一个查询词,系统返回的结果要么与需求相去甚远,要么遗漏了大量相关信息。某科技公司内部调研显示,超过六成的员工认为知识库搜索“很难找到真正需要的内容”。
这种问题的根源在于传统关键词匹配模式的局限性。当用户搜索“如何处理客户投诉”时,系统只能匹配包含完整“如何处理客户投诉”字样的文档,而无法理解“投诉处理流程”“客户异议解决方案”等语义相关的内容。这导致大量有价值的信息被淹没在搜索结果之外。
1.2 索引更新滞后导致信息时效性差
知识库的价值在于信息的时效性与准确性。然而许多企业的搜索索引仍采用定时批量更新模式,新上传的文档往往需要数小时甚至数天才能被检索到。某电商平台的运营人员曾反映,促销方案上线后,客服团队通过知识库搜索到的仍是旧版本指引,引发多起客诉。
这种延迟背后是技术架构的权衡。实时索引意味着更高的系统资源消耗与运维成本,而多数企业选择在效率与时效性之间做出妥协。
1.3 多源异构数据的统一检索困难
现代企业知识库的数据来源日益多元,包含Word文档、PDF文件、在线表格、数据库记录、网页内容等多种格式。不同数据源的存储结构、字段定义、编码方式存在显著差异,给统一检索带来极大挑战。
更为复杂的是,同一信息往往分散在多个系统中。例如产品规格参数可能同时存在于ERP系统、产品数据库和客服知识库,当用户从不同入口搜索时,获得的结果可能相互矛盾。这种数据孤岛问题至今仍是企业知识管理领域的顽疾。
1.4 用户查询意图识别困难
用户的搜索行为往往具有模糊性与多样性。同一个问题,不同用户的表达方式可能截然不同。有的人会搜索具体症状,有的人会搜索目标结果,还有的人会用口语化表达描述需求。
传统搜索系统缺乏对用户意图的深层理解能力,只能进行表层的词项匹配。这导致搜索系统无法区分“苹果”是水果还是手机品牌,也无法从“内存不足”这一模糊描述推断用户需要的是系统清理教程还是硬件升级指南。
1.5 搜索性能与用户体验的矛盾
当知识库规模达到一定体量后,搜索性能与结果质量之间的矛盾愈发突出。为了返回更全面的结果,系统需要遍历更多数据,但这会导致响应时间延长;而追求响应速度又可能牺牲结果召回率。

某金融机构的知识库收录了超过两百万份文档,搜索响应时间一度超过八秒,用户抱怨“等搜索结果的时间自己都找到了答案”。这种性能瓶颈严重制约了知识库的实用价值。
二、问题根源深度剖析
2.1 技术层面的根本制约
当前多数企业知识库采用的全文检索技术源自数据库时代的词项倒排索引方案,这套技术框架在处理海量非结构化数据时存在天然局限。它只能识别字面匹配,无法理解词汇之间的语义关系;它将文档视为词项的集合,忽视了词序、上下文等重要信息。
更深层的问题在于知识图谱构建的缺失。没有建立起概念之间的关联网络,搜索系统就无法进行推理与扩展,只能在有限的词项空间内打转。某制造业企业的技术负责人曾坦言,他们的知识库“只是一个大型文件系统,离真正的知识管理还有很大距离”。
2.2 数据治理层面的历史欠账
很多企业的知识库建设经历了“先上线后优化”的路径,早期缺乏统一的数据标准与质量管控机制。这导致大量重复文档、过时信息、无效内容沉积在知识库中,成为搜索质量的拖累。
更棘手的是元数据管理的缺失。文档的创建时间、所属部门、关联业务、更新状态等描述性信息不完整,系统就无法进行针对性过滤与排序,用户不得不在大量相关性参差的结果中自行筛选。
2.3 用户层面的使用习惯差异
不同角色、不同时期的用户搜索行为存在显著差异。熟悉业务的老员工可能知道精确的术语与文档编号,而新员工则倾向于使用自然语言描述。这种差异使得搜索系统难以建立统一的效果衡量标准,也增加了优化的难度。
同时,用户的搜索素养也影响着体验质量。部分用户缺乏有效的关键词提取能力,习惯输入整句甚至整段话进行搜索,这超出了大多数搜索系统的处理能力边界。
三、实用可行的优化策略
3.1 引入语义理解能力
提升搜索质量的核心路径是让系统具备语义理解能力。这需要从传统的词项匹配升级为向量检索,将文档与查询转换为高维空间中的向量,通过计算向量相似度来衡量语义关联。
小浣熊AI智能助手在这方面的实践值得关注。其采用的大语言模型技术能够理解用户的自然语言表述,即使查询与文档措辞不同,只要语义相近就能返回相关结果。例如用户搜索“电脑开不了机”,系统同样能够召回包含“机器无法启动”“主机不通电”等表述的故障排除文档。
具体实施时,企业可以基于通用语义模型进行领域微调,使模型更好地理解行业特有的专业术语与表达习惯。某医疗信息企业的测试数据显示,经过医疗领域微调后,搜索召回率提升了约三成。
3.2 建立增量实时索引机制
针对信息时效性痛点,建议采用增量索引与实时更新相结合的技术方案。当新文档上传或现有文档修改时,系统自动触发索引更新流程,无需等待批量任务调度。
这一方案的技术实现并不复杂。主流的搜索引擎如Elasticsearch均支持近实时索引功能,关键在于合理的任务调度与资源分配。初期可以设置较短的更新间隔(如五分钟),待系统稳定后根据实际负载调整。

同时应建立文档生命周期管理机制,自动标记或归档超过一定时限的文档,避免过时信息干扰搜索结果。
3.3 实施数据标准化与元数据治理
解决多源数据检索困难的根本在于数据治理。建议从三个层面推进这项工作:
首先,统一文档命名规范与分类体系。制定清晰的目录结构与标签规则,确保新增文档符合标准。
其次,完善元数据采集。在文档上传环节强制填写关键字段,包括文档类型、所属业务线、有效期、责任人等。这些元数据不仅有助于精准检索,还能支撑后续的权限控制与统计分析。
最后,建立数据同步机制。对于分散在不同系统中的关联信息,通过统一接口实现定期同步,保持知识库内容的全局一致性。
3.4 构建多轮对话与意图澄清能力
针对用户意图识别困难的问题,建议在搜索功能基础上增加对话式交互能力。当首次搜索结果不理想时,系统可以主动与用户确认需求细节。
例如用户搜索“内存不足”,系统可以返回多个可能的意图选项“是指手机存储空间不足还是电脑运行内存不足”,引导用户选择后提供针对性结果。这种交互方式虽然增加了操作步骤,却能显著提升最终结果的准确性。
小浣熊AI智能助手的实践表明,通过多轮对话将模糊需求逐步澄清,用户的搜索满意度可以提升四成以上。
3.5 优化性能与用户体验平衡
搜索性能优化需要综合考虑多个技术环节:
查询改写是性价比最高的手段。系统自动对用户输入进行规范化处理,包括去除停用词、提取核心关键词、处理拼写错误等,减少无效的检索计算。
缓存策略可以显著提升重复查询的响应速度。对于高频常见查询,系统直接将结果缓存,用户几乎可以即时获得返回。
分页与渐进加载能够在保证结果完整性的同时改善感知性能。先返回最相关的少量结果,让用户快速看到价值,再根据需要加载更多。
结果摘要功能让用户无需打开每个文档就能判断内容相关性,减少不必要的点击与等待。
3.6 建立效果评估与持续优化机制
搜索优化不是一次性工程,而是需要持续迭代的过程。建议建立系统的效果评估体系,通过埋点数据监控以下核心指标:
- 搜索结果点击率:反映结果相关性
- 无结果搜索占比:发现覆盖盲区
- 平均点击位置:评估排序合理性
- 用户搜索后行为:判断意图达成情况
基于数据分析结果,定期进行Bad Case分析与优化策略调整,形成闭环改进。某互联网企业的实践表明,建立持续优化机制后,搜索满意度在半年内提升了十五个百分点。
总结
知识库搜索优化是一项系统性工程,涉及技术架构、数据治理、用户体验等多个维度。的核心经验表明,单纯依靠技术升级难以彻底解决问题,必须将技术创新与数据治理、流程优化相结合。
对于大多数企业而言,建议采取渐进式改进路径:先完善基础的数据治理与元数据管理,再逐步引入语义理解等高级能力,最后建立持续优化机制形成良性循环。在这个过程中,保持对用户真实需求的关注至关重要——技术手段只是工具,真正有价值的是帮助用户快速找到所需信息这一目标本身。
搜索体验的提升没有终点,唯有持续倾听用户反馈、不断迭代优化,才能让知识库真正发挥其信息资产的价值。




















